Categories Art Food Ramen Restaurant Post author By Jean Snow Post date February 8, 2017 I really love this illustration by Mateusz Urbanowicz that he shared in a tweet, of a ramen shop he visited. Tags Illustration, mateusz urbanowicz, ramen, ramen shop By Jean Snow Production Services Manager at Ubisoft Shanghai. Before that, half a life spent in Tokyo. View Archive → ← Where They Create: Japan → Supplement Two